Description

Offered for sale is a unique collection of sixty seven (67) still sealed American LP releases by pop singer Julie London, issued between 1955 and 1969.  All 67 LPs in the collection are still sealed (60 in shrink wrap, and 7 without shrink but with the record still sealed in a plastic inner sleeve.)  There are 37 different titles in the collection, including two compilations.

Most of the titles include both the mono and stereo releases for that particular title.  One of the compilations, Julie’s Golden Greats, includes two different covers, with each in both mono and stereo.

While some of Julie’s albums are more common than others, sealed copies of many of her titles are quite difficult to find today.

This collection isn’t complete, but all but one of her albums is represented here (missing title: Send for Me)  Nevertheless, it’s a very rare opportunity to obtain a nearly complete collection of sealed albums by this popular and photogenic artist.
